    Put the insulation boards down on top of a layer of conventional insulation last year. Not to stressful! Things to watch out for are cables and pipes running across joists and mark positions of the joists so you know where to put your screw into.

    Stay in a lot of B+B’s for work! Things my work buddy and I look for are in no particular order

    Clean and welcoming.
    If a twin room decent space between the beds.
    En-suite with a bath and a shower(helps if the shower is powerful and hot)
    Good breakfast with decent bacon and sausages.
    Comfy bed with a duvet big enough to cover you.
    Black out curtains.
    Window that opens
    Good toilet and sink combo (the ability to have a bowel movement and a spew at the same time is handy)
    Free Wi-Fi

    Things we don’t like
    Carpet in the bathroom.
    Decent sized room not cluttered with pointless chairs and tables.
    Out of date UHT milk.
    Glade plug-ins in every second socket.
